I had serious issues breathing at night when I slept. My nose was off center from a soft ball accident when I was young. In addition, I had a very masculine nose and I wanted to soften my face. Dr. Torgerson has a state of the art facility and is an ENT doctor - both are wins. He will guide you through 3D imaging as he shows you the possibilities for your corrective surgery. Dr. Torgerson practices closed techniques for rhinoplasty, which for me, was important since I wanted as little scar evidence as possible and the risk for infection is much lower in closed versus open surgery. His staff are friendly and Dr. Torgerson is interested in helping you meet your goals. Feel confident in his care and he will show you what is possible. He offers other services and I chose to do laser skin resurfacing with my rhinoplasty. I am also very happy with the results from this procedure.

I do not feel any cons- only pros- I suppose the only con is that it will never be exactly perfect but that in turn is a good thing because you want to look human. We are flawed and it's a good thing. I had no bruising, the recovery was extremely fast. Maybe 2 weeks maximum. The most difficult part was when they remove the gauze stuffing from your nose. But the it's over and done with and your nose heals quickly. I live part of the year in an extremely hot humid climate - I was more aware of the swelling down here then while I was in Toronto.
